About Round Valley Elementary

Round Valley Elementary is a public school in Bishop, California serving kindergarten through fifth grade with 69 students. Its student-to-teacher ratio of 11.5:1 keeps classes small and instruction focused. Academically, the school earns a composite score of 9.5 out of 10, rated Exceptional, with a 9.3 in academics and a 9.5 in growth.

Those numbers translate directly into peer rankings: Round Valley sits at #29 out of 9,533 public schools in California and #28 out of 5,817 elementary schools statewide. It ranks first among the four public schools in Bishop. By composite measure, it outperforms 100% of California schools — a distinction that places it among the very top performers in the state regardless of size or district.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Round Valley Elementary has a median household income of $81,695. It is an area where 37%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$434,900, with a median rent of $1,340/month. The local poverty rate of 9.4% is relatively low. Residents enjoy a short average commute of 16 minutes.
